/* CSS Document */
* {
margin: 0;
padding: 0;
}
body{margin:0;padding:0;background-color:white;}



#head{position:relative;margin-left:2px;width:911px;height:111px;background-image:url(../images/header.jpg);background-repeat:no-repeat;}
#conteneur2{width:911px;*width:911px;_width:911px;float:left;min-height:700px;height:900px;}
#conteneur_page{ position:relative;float:left;width:664px;height:auto;min-height:600px;top:23px;margin-left:42px;_margin-left:15px;}

/* titre et texte page */
h1 {font: bold  30px Trebuchet MS;color:#ae609e;line-height:30px;}
h2 {font: normal  18px Trebuchet MS;color:#ae609e;line-height:30px;}
.courrant1{font:bold 13px Trebuchet MS;color:#8b8b8b;line-height:18px;}
.grand_vert{font:bold 15px Trebuchet MS;color:#c1b515;line-height:18px;}
ul li {font: 13px Trebuchet MS;color:#8b8b8b;line-height:18px;}

#verti{position:relative;float:left;width:8px;margin-top:10px;height:752px;margin-left:4px; background:url(../JNPO/images/filet_verti.jpg) no-repeat;}

#col_droite{ position:relative;float:left;width:179px;height:760px;margin-left:5px;_margin-left:5px;top:12px;}
#col_haut{position:relative;clear:both;width:168px;height:386px;background:url(images/fond_col_haut.jpg);margin-left:8px;_margin-left:0px;background-repeat:no-repeat;}
#col_bas{position:relative;width:168px;height:363px;background:url(../JNPO/images/fond_col_bas.jpg);margin-top:-35px;*margin-top:0px;_margin-top:2px;margin-left:8px;_margin-left:0px;background-repeat:no-repeat;}



/* menu haut */
#onglet{width:931px; float:left; height:36px} 
.menu li{ display:block; float:left; margin-left:9px;margin-top:5px}
a.image1 {display:block; width:120px; height:36px; background:url(../JNPO/images/off1.jpg) no-repeat;}
a.image1:hover{display:block; width:120px; height:36px; background:url(../JNPO/images/on1.jpg) no-repeat;}
a.image2 {display:block; width:120px; height:36px; background:url(../JNPO/images/off2.jpg) no-repeat;}
a.image2:hover{display:block; width:120px; height:36px; background:url(../JNPO/images/on2.jpg) no-repeat;}
a.image3 {display:block; width:120px; height:36px; background:url(../JNPO/images/off3.jpg) no-repeat;}
a.image3:hover{display:block; width:120px; height:36px; background:url(../JNPO/images/on3.jpg) no-repeat;}

a.image4 {display:block; width:120px; height:36px; background:url(../JNPO/images/off4.jpg) no-repeat;}
a.image4:hover{display:block; width:120px; height:36px; background:url(../JNPO/images/on4.jpg) no-repeat;}

a.image5 {display:block; width:120px; height:36px; background:url(../JNPO/images/off55.jpg) no-repeat;}
a.image5:hover{display:block; width:120px; height:36px; background:url(../JNPO/images/on5.jpg) no-repeat;}

a.image6 {display:block; width:120px; height:36px; background:url(../JNPO/images/off66.jpg) no-repeat;}
a.image6:hover{display:block; width:120px; height:36px; background:url(../JNPO/images/on6.jpg) no-repeat;}

a.image7 {display:block; width:120px; height:36px; background:url(../JNPO/images/off77.jpg) no-repeat;}
a.image7:hover{display:block; width:120px; height:36px; background:url(../JNPO/images/on7.jpg) no-repeat;}

/* images rouge vert bleu jaune */
#carre_bleu{position:relative;float:left;margin-left:0px;_margin-left:5px;width:306px;height:176px;margin-top:58px;margin-right:22px;_margin-right:27px;background:url(../JNPO/images/carrebleu.jpg) no-repeat;}
#carre_vert{position:relative;float:left;width:306px;height:176px;margin-top:58px;background:url(../JNPO/images/carre_vert.jpg) no-repeat;}
#carre_rouge{position:relative;float:left;margin-left:0px;_margin-left:5px;width:306px;height:176px;margin-right:22px;_margin-right:27px;margin-top:55px;background:url(../JNPO/images/carre_rouge.jpg) no-repeat;}
#carre_jaune{position:relative;float:left;width:306px;height:176px;margin-top:55px;margin-right:15px;background:url(../JNPO/images/carre_jaune.jpg) no-repeat;}


/* colonne droite */
ul.liste { margin:0;padding:0;}
.liste li{list-style-type:none;padding-bottom:8px;*padding-bottom:16px;_padding-bottom:16px;list-style-image:url(../JNPO/images/puce.jpg); }
.liste a{ font: bold 14px Trebuchet MS;color:#EEA61E;text-decoration:none;line-height:10px}
.liste a:hover{ font: normal 14px Trebuchet MS;color:#3b65ee;text-decoration:none;line-height:10px}
#partenaires{ position:relative;width:158px;height:310px;margin-top:40px;left:5px;}

/* footer */
#footer{position:relative;clear:both;width:928px;_width:928px;height:44px;background-image:url(../JNPO/images/footer.jpg); background-repeat:no-repeat;}
.contact{font: bold 14px Trebuchet MS;color:#bfbfbf;text-decoration:none;}
.tel{font: bold 12px Trebuchet MS;color:white;text-decoration:none;}




